2026 Data and Software Engineering Grad Intern

The Aerospace Corporation

$32 - $35
Dec 30, 2025
El Segundo, CA, US

The Aerospace Corporation is looking to solve the hardest problems in space programs, providing innovative solutions that span satellite, launch, ground, and cyber systems for defense, civil and commercial customers.

Requirements

  • Proficiency in solid modeling and MATLAB for simulation, analysis, and data processing
  • Strong understanding in data engineering, architectures, and platform integration
  • Demonstrated research experience with data ontologies and knowledge graphs
  • Experience with databases and data management systems
  • Cloud-native application development and deployment and familiarity with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, Platform One, etc
  • Knowledge of backend and middleware development, as well as ontologies and knowledge graphs
  • Experience with data security and governance technologies

Responsibilities

  • Working closely with National Security Space, United States Space Force, and other Department of Defense customers
  • Providing data engineering and data architecture solutions for the space enterprise
  • Developing cutting edge, modern, and smart data platforms and capabilities enabling further advanced analytics, modeling and simulation, and artificial intelligence
  • Leading development and developing highly resilient and efficient data platforms
  • Increasing velocity and innovation for Aerospace and our customers through the development of data platforms
  • Data engineering is at the center of many developing and future information systems and holds a key role in the organization at large
  • Customers rely on our capabilities as data volumes continue to grow at exponential rates

Other

  • Currently enrolled full-time in an accredited college/university program pursuing a Master's or Ph.D. degree in Computer Science or related engineering discipline
  • Availability to work full-time for a minimum of 10 weeks outside of university term and ability to return to a degree program full-time after completion of the internship
  • Minimum GPA of 3.0
  • Must work well in a team environment
  • Possess organizational, time management and project management skills
